Output ef3e9880861bec1a683d4a88da02145bf683aa76d7a7e5fe2bc400fd343f274f:1

value
129969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c120268ab2289771ea1acb3f24daa46a6b70317f OP_EQUAL
address
3KJArRhZZ9R41j458Ni2UT49dShKPd3rw5
transaction
ef3e9880861bec1a683d4a88da02145bf683aa76d7a7e5fe2bc400fd343f274f
spent
true